Just a few things found in Reader's Digest or other print media over the years . . . .

Q - What occurs in the United States more often in December than any other month?
A - Conception.

Q - Boat owners have a tendency to name their boats. What is the most popular name selected?
A - Second Wind.

Q - What do Kevlar (used in bulletproof vests), fire escapes, windshield wipers, and Snugli infant carriers have in common?
A - All were invented by women.

* * * * *

According to the Internet: Students in a Harvard English 101 class were asked to write a concise essay containing four elements: religion, royalty, sex, and mystery.

The only A+ in the class read: "My God," said the Queen, "I'm pregnant! I wonder who did it?"

Disaster Strikes!

Post by SilverLady(SO) »

"Oh, no!" he gasped as he surveyed the disaster before him. Never in his 40 years of life had he seen anything like it. How anyone could have survived he did not know. He could only hope that somewhere amid the overwhelming destruction he would find his 16-year old son. Only the slim hope of finding Danny kept him from turning and fleeing the scene.

He took a deep breath and proceeded. Walking was virtually impossible with so many things strewn across his path. He moved ahead slowly. "Danny! Danny!" he whispered to himself. He tripped and almost fell several times.

He heard someone, or something, move. At least he thought he did. Perhaps he was just hoping he did. He shook his head and felt his gut tighten. He couldn't understand how this could have happened.

There was some light but not enough to see very much. Something cold and wet brushed against his hand. He jerked it away. In desperation, he took another step, then cried out, "Danny!" From a nearby pile of unidentified material, he heard his son.

"Yes, Dad," he said, in a voice so weak it could hardly be heard.

"It's time to get up and get ready for school," the man sighed, "and for heaven's sake, clean up this room!"
